如何使用Containerd CTR删除集装箱?

von4xj4u  于 2022-09-19  发布在  Docker
关注(0)|答案(1)|浏览(193)

我使用sudo ctr container run ...来运行容器。但我的容器中的流程有问题。因此,我认为没有任务正在运行。我使用sudo ctr task ls,它显示,

TASK         PID    STATUS
test    0      CREATED

然后我想用sudo ctr task kill test杀死它。然而,它表明,

ctr: process not started: unknown

然后我使用sudo ctr task delete test。它还显示错误,

ctr: task must be stopped before deletion: created: failed precondition

我不知道如何删除这个容器。一旦我删除了这个容器,它就附带了ctr: task must be stopped before deletion: created: failed precondition。如何删除此容器?

bq3bfh9z

bq3bfh9z1#

你可以试试这条路。

ps aux | grep shim
sudo kill -9 <pid of your process>

相关问题